Sky Pony, Indie-Popstars Perform a Halloween Concert, 10/30

On Sunday October 30, Brooklyn band Sky-Ponywill present a Halloween extravaganza at Rockwood Music Hall Stage 2. Expect costumes, surprises, and a healthy dose of their lush and theatrical indie-pop. Led by Tony nominee Lauren Worsham(Gentleman's Guide to Love and Mirder) and her husband, Obie winning songwriter Kyle Jarrow,Sky-Pony has been called 'a beautiful mash-up of music, choreography, costumes, projections and drama' by The Village Voice and 'tight, fierce, hilarious and out of their minds' by The Wall Street Journal. They've built a cult following for their high-energy live shows.

Greenway Arts Alliance Presents George Orwell's 1984

"War is Peace, Freedom is Slavery and Ignorance is Strength."  Greenway Arts Alliance Presents: George Orwell's 1984, directed by Kate Jopson as the first production of their novel to stage program Greenway Reads. 300 Fairfax High School students are reading the novel and will attend matinee's of the theatrical production. The adaptation by Alan Lyddiard creates an interactive and engaging experience for audience members. Jopson said, "We're trying to create an immersive experience. The elements of the play and its themes are all around us in the real world. We try to emphasize that and as soon as you arrive at the theater there's not anywhere you're not in the set of 1984, even in the lobby and bathrooms."

See the First Performance of TICK, TICK... BOOM! Off-Broadway for 20 Bucks

Today Keen Artistic Director Jonathan Silverstein announced that tickets for the first performance of Jonathan Larson's Tick, Tick…BOOM!  on Tuesday October 4th will be only $19.90 for all seats in honor of the year Tick, Tick…BOOM! was first workshopped Off-Off-Broadway (September 1990), as well as the year the musical takes place. 

Photo Flash: Electric Footlights' DON'T ASK ABOUT BECKET Opens

It's been years since he disappeared, but Emily Diamond is still haunted by dreams of her twin brother, Becket. Kiff Scholl directs the world premiere of Please Don't Ask About Becket, an enthralling family drama by Wendy Graf (All American Girl, No Word In Guyanese for Me) opening August 20 in an Electric Footlightsproduction at the Sacred Fools Theater Black Box.

New York Festival of Song Sets 2016-17 Season

NEW YORK FESTIVAL OF SONG (Steven Blier, Artistic Director; Michael Barrett, Associate Artistic Director) has announced its 2016-17 season, including Hot-off-the-press premieres by Adam Guettel, Gabriel Kahane, William Bolcom; A performance of Paul Bowles and James Schuyler's surrealistic and witty Picnic Cantata, a rare, mid-century modern gem;Sumptuous songs of Tchaikovsky and his circle, part of the New York Philharmonic's 'Beloved Friend-Tchaikovsky and his World' Festival; Dazzling comic turns by singer-actors Mary Testa, Lauren Worsham, Hal Cazalet; Two brilliant baritones just entering their prime, American balladeer John Brancy and Russian titan Alexey Lavrov; National Sawdust welcomes the moveable, modern salon NYFOS Next with performances curated by Christopher Cerrone, Gabriela Lena Frank, Kyle Jarrow, Lauren Worsham.

Alison Fraser & Stephen Bogardus to Lead Reading of New Musical INTO THE WILD

?Rhinebeck Writers Retreat is presenting a reading of the new musical, INTO THE WILD, book and lyrics by Janet Allard and music and lyrics by Niko Tsakalakos, on June 13 in New York City for an invited industry audience. INTO THE WILD is based on the acclaimed best selling book by Jon Krakauer and "Back to the Wild" by the Christopher J. McCandless Foundation.
